Kolkata, Sep 11 (Reporter) West Bengal doctors on Wednesday continued their protest outside the state health secretariat demanding resignation of three top department officials but conveyed to the Chief Minister’s Office that they were open to holding talks only with Mamata Banerjee for ending the deadlock resulting from the murder of their colleague in R G Kar Medical College and Hospital on August 9. The medics, under the umbrella of West Bengal Junior Doctors Front, on Tuesday refused to go to the secretariat following an invitation for talks from the principal health secretary. "We are open for a talk at any time and any place provided the highest authority invites us and the delegation must not be less than 25 members among the doctors," said a medic who spent the whole night with his other fellows at the protest site...////...
